CVE-2018-5387: Improper Verification of Cryptographic Signature

May 13, 2022 (updated July 19, 2023)

Wizkunde SAMLBase may incorrectly utilize the results of XML DOM traversal and canonicalization APIs in such a way that an attacker may be able to manipulate the SAML data without invalidating the cryptographic signature, allowing the attack to potentially bypass authentication to SAML service providers.

Affected versions

All versions before 1.2.7

Fixed versions

  • 1.2.7

Solution

Upgrade to version 1.2.7 or above.

Impact 7.5 HIGH

C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:H/A:N

Learn more about CVSS

Weakness

  • CWE-347: Improper Verification of Cryptographic Signature
